Chico has a lot opting for solar. The Sacramento Valley gets strong sunlight for much of the year, summer cooling costs can bite hard, and many house owners are seeking a method to bring even more predictability to monthly power prices. That combination makes property solar a very easy subject to talk about and a harder one to navigate well.

The hard part is not determining whether solar Chico solar installation can work in Chico. Most of the times, it can. The tough part is choosing the right installer, comprehending what sort of system actually fits your home, and preventing the sales shortcuts that transform a great financial investment right into a frustrating one.

If you have actually searched for solar setup companies near me or compared a few solar installers near me, you have possibly seen something promptly: numerous proposals look comparable on the surface. Same assurances, similar panels, comparable financing language, exact same glossy cost savings estimate. Yet as soon as you look better, the distinctions matter. The installer's style choices, workmanship standards, communication, and after-sale support often have extra influence on your experience than the panel brand name published on the brochure.

For house owners seeking solar setup Chico services, a clever decision starts with neighborhood fit. Chico homes differ greater than individuals recognize. Older neighborhoods can have mature tree cover and aging electrical panels. Newer homes may have cleaner rooflines and much better effectiveness, yet still encounter orientation or shading issues. Some houses run swimming pool pumps, electrical cars, and hefty air conditioning loads. Others want a smaller sized system merely to offset component of a costs without overcommitting financially. Great installers represent those distinctions. Weak ones sell the exact same package to everyone.

Why neighborhood experience matters in Chico

There is a genuine advantage in working with solar installers Chico home owners already recognize by reputation. Solar is not nearly setting modules on a roof covering. It touches roof covering problems, attic access, circuit box, energy affiliation, and regional allowing. A firm that works in Chico regularly usually has a better feel for these details than one that treats the city as just another quit on a wide regional map.

That local experience appears in practical ways. An installer with experience in Chico may acknowledge common roofing types in the area, understand what utility documentation often tends to slow down approvals, and recognize how summer season warmth impacts organizing and crew productivity. They might also be extra practical concerning setup timelines. A firm that assures a lightning-fast turnaround without inspecting license tons, panel upgrades, or roofing system condition is usually selling positive outlook as opposed to a grounded plan.

I have actually seen home owners focus so heavily on devices brands that they ignore the basics. Then the task stalls due to the fact that the installer did not flag an obsolete main panel till after agreement signing, or since the roof needed repair initially, or because shading from a big south-side tree made the initial production price quote as well aggressive. A seasoned local installer tends to find those issues earlier.

The initial inquiry is not cost, it is fit

Price matters, naturally. Solar is a major home improvement acquisition. Yet contrasting quotes by complete buck quantity alone rarely brings about the very best choice. The far better concern is whether the system fits your home, your electrical use, and your long-term plans.

An excellent proposal ought to start with your actual intake background. In Chico, seasonal swings can be remarkable. A home that remains moderate in springtime can surge dramatically in July and August when cooling runs hard. If you plan to purchase an EV, set up a heatpump water heater, or convert gas devices to electrical, your future use might look very various from your last year of bills.

This is where the most effective installers identify themselves. They ask about way of life adjustments. They do not just size a system to in 2014's number and move on. They also describe trade-offs. A somewhat larger system might cost more currently yet safeguard you from rising use later on. A smaller sized system may deliver a much better immediate repayment if your budget is tight. Neither choice is immediately best. Context matters.

What a strong solar proposal must include

When a solar estimate is solid, it reviews much less like a sales flyer and more like a thoughtful building and construction plan. It ought to explain expected system dimension, estimated annual production, roof layout, major tools, service warranty terms, and assumptions about shading and usage. It should additionally be clear concerning what is not included.

Many house owners miss the value of exemptions. If a quote does not spell out whether a major panel upgrade, subpanel job, roofing repairs, pest guard, monitoring setup, or authorization charges are consisted of, the preliminary price can become much less purposeful. Transparent business are usually in advance concerning those boundaries because they understand shocks harm trust.

Pay very close attention to production price quotes. A system in Chico can carry out very well, however just if the assumptions are sincere. If one quote projects significantly higher result than the others, ask local solar installation companies why. It might show much better style. It could also reflect positive modeling options about shade, azimuth, temperature losses, or system derating. Higher projected production makes the financials look much better on paper, so it deserves pressing for specifics.

Roof condition can make or damage the project

One of the most typical blunders in domestic solar is mounting on a roof that is near completion of its useful life. If your roof covering might need substitute within the following a number of years, it deserves attending to that before solar goes on. Eliminating and reinstalling a system later includes expense and inconvenience. It can additionally introduce finger-pointing between professions if leakages or blinking concerns show up afterward.

In Chico, where extreme summertime warm and sun exposure can mature roofing materials unevenly, this is worthy of an actual inspection instead of a fast glance from the ground. The ideal installer will certainly not wave away roof covering problems just to close the deal. They will certainly tell you plainly if your tiles, underlayment, or outdoor decking condition raises a red flag.

That sincerity can save thousands. It might really feel frustrating in the moment, especially if you aspire to move forward, however a professional who pauses a solar sale because the roof is not ready is typically the one worth trusting.

Electrical job is where experience shows

Solar propositions commonly make the system itself look easy. Panels on the roof, inverter on the wall, a little conduit, done. In reality, the electric side is where task intricacy commonly lives.

Older homes in and around Chico might have circuit box that are undersized, crowded, or dated. Some need a primary panel upgrade prior to solar can be securely adjoined. Others can collaborate with a load-side link, a line-side faucet, or other code-compliant techniques relying on the existing setup and utility requirements. A strong installer discusses these choices in simple language and does not make believe all homes are interchangeable.

This matters due to the fact that electric surprises are among one of the most common factors final pricing adjustments after contract finalizing. If an installer provides you a quote without completely reviewing panel photos, lots estimations, and website problems, be careful. That reduced number may just be an insufficient number.

The funding conversation is entitled to extra scrutiny

Solar financing can be helpful, but it can additionally blur the true expense of the system. Regular monthly repayment presentations frequently sound eye-catching because they frame the project as a costs swap. The pitch is basic: pay this rather than that. The issue is that funding terms, dealership costs, price frameworks, and presumptions regarding utility inflation can substantially influence the economics.

A house owner comparing solar installation companies near me must ask for both money price and financed cost. If there is a big gap, ask what develops it. Sometimes the answer is a considerable supplier charge built into the funding framework. That does not immediately make financing poor, however it does indicate you must recognize what you are buying.

Leases and power purchase agreements can make sense in some situations, specifically for homeowners that value reduced ahead of time cost and marginal upkeep duty. Still, they are not the same as possession. If you prepare to remain in your home long term and can comfortably fund or pay money, ownership often offers more powerful long-range worth. If you may offer in a couple of years, the transfer terms matter a lot. Purchasers and representatives differ in exactly how they view leased solar.

A reputable installer will go over these trade-offs without attempting to require one course. If every inquiry concerning expense gets redirected right into a monthly payment script, that is an indication to slow down down.

Batteries deserve discussing, however not every person needs one

Storage has actually come to be a huge part of the solar discussion, specifically in areas where grid dependability and optimal power prices are problems. In Chico, batteries can give actual value for backup power and better monitoring of home energy use. They can maintain essentials running throughout outages and help homes rely much less on the grid throughout costly periods.

That stated, batteries are still a significant added expense. The best option relies on your objectives. If you function from home, have clinical tools, store temperature-sensitive medication, or simply want strength during failures, storage might be worth serious consideration. If your primary goal is reducing your electrical expense and your spending plan is limited, you might be better served by placing those bucks into a properly designed solar range first.

What issues is that the installer deals with batteries as a layout choice, not an automatic upsell. Excellent companies ask what tons you want supported. They talk through compromises such as whole-home backup versus vital lots backup, expected runtime, and just how summer evening usage influences battery sizing.

Sales behavior informs you greater than the brochure

By the moment most home owners speak to solar installers near me, they currently have enough standard details to understand solar is technically feasible. The question becomes whom to depend on. In my experience, sales habits is frequently the clearest indicator.

A positive expert does not need to create fake urgency. They do not insist on a same-day trademark to secure a deal that inexplicably expires tonight. They do not evade thorough inquiries about roof accessories, solution job, guarantees, or surveillance. They do not bury contract language under a stream of vague reassurance.

Instead, they slow down the process down where it should be sluggish. They review your usage. They mention layout restraints. They reveal where tools will go. They explain what occurs if manufacturing underperforms assumptions. They clarify that takes care of service if an inverter stops working five years later.

Here are a couple of signs you are speaking to a severe installer rather than a fast-moving sales operation:

  1. They testimonial your past electrical usage and inquire about future changes.
  2. They discuss system design selections rather than just pricing quote electrical power and payment.
  3. They check roofing and electrical problems thoroughly before settling price.
  4. They supply a clear range of work, consisting of exemptions and guarantee responsibilities.
  5. They remain receptive after the proposal, not just before the signature.

That sort of discipline may really feel much less amazing than a refined pitch, however it typically results in a smoother project.

Warranties matter, however handiwork matters more

Homeowners typically read about panel warranties initially since they are simple to market. A 25-year item or performance service warranty seems reassuring, and it can be. However devices guarantees only solve part of the problem. If a system has flashing problems, avenue runs that look careless, poor cable administration, or an installment format that catches particles and makes complex roof accessibility, a lengthy panel warranty will not deal with the hidden top quality issue.

Workmanship is what you deal with daily. It affects appearance, use, weather condition resistance, and long-lasting integrity. Ask how the installer takes care of roof penetrations, what mounting systems they utilize, how they take care of conduit transmitting, and whether they farm out labor or use internal crews. There is no global right solution on subcontracting, but there ought to be a clear answer.

If possible, ask to see pictures of completed local jobs. Not glamor shots, real installment images. Tidy rail positioning, tidy channel paths, thoughtful tools positioning, and organized labeling claim a whole lot regarding a business's standards.

Communication during permitting and interconnection

Solar jobs have silent stretches that can frustrate home owners. You sign the agreement, residential solar installers Chico perhaps finish a website go to, and afterwards not much appears to occur. Behind the scenes, allowing, utility approvals, design revisions, and organizing all take time. This is typical. Poor interaction is not.

One of the most common problems concerning solar installers Chico residents share is not constantly bad setup quality. It is radio silence during the center of the task. A solid installer sets assumptions early. They inform you what actions follow, what can create hold-ups, and when you will speak with them. They do not make you chase after updates every week.

This issues because solar is not a one-day acquisition also if the roofing system work itself only takes a day or two. From agreement to approval to operate, timelines can vary. Property owners who understand the sequence often tend to have a much better experience, specifically when a straightforward hold-up shows up. Silence produces anxiousness. Clear updates protect trust.

Comparing quotes without getting lost

If you accumulate 3 or 4 proposals, it assists to contrast them with a useful lens rather than attempting to grasp every technical specification. Ask yourself which firm appears to have actually studied your home, which approximate feels clear, and which manufacturing assumptions appear grounded.

A lower rate can be the right option if the range is genuinely equal and the installer has a strong track record. A greater price can be warranted if it includes significant electric work, stronger service assistance, or a better layout for your roof covering geometry and consumption pattern. What you intend to avoid is an incorrect comparison where one company prices a full job and an additional rates a simpler version that will grow a lot more expensive later.

It is likewise worth remembering that the most affordable service provider in construction-heavy work frequently becomes the most costly lesson. Solar integrates roofing, electric, allowing, and long-lasting support. That is a great deal of places for edges to be cut.

Questions worth asking prior to you sign

A brief collection of straight concerns can expose a great deal concerning an installer's deepness and sincerity. You do not require to interrogate any individual, but you should leave the discussion with clear answers.

Ask these prior to you commit:

  1. What presumptions are you utilizing for shielding, yearly production, and future utility costs?
  2. Is any type of electrical upgrade likely, and if so, is it included in this price?
  3. Who does the installation job, and that manages service phone calls later?
  4. What occurs if my roof needs repair or substitute faster than expected?
  5. How long must I genuinely get out of signing to authorization to operate?

None of these inquiries are exotic. A dependable company ought to address them straight and comfortably.

How much does it cost to install solar panels on a 2,000 sq ft home in Chico?

A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home typically costs between $18,000 and $40,000 before incentives. Actual costs depend on electricity usage, system size, equipment quality, and installation complexity. Homes with higher energy consumption may require larger systems. Available incentives can significantly reduce the final cost.

How many solar panels are needed to run a house in Chico?

The number of solar panels required depends on household electricity consumption and panel efficiency. Most homes require between 15 and 30 panels to offset a significant portion of annual energy use. Larger homes or higher electricity usage may require additional panels. A professional assessment is typically used to determine system size.

What is the downside of getting solar panels in Chico?

The primary downside of solar panels is the upfront installation cost. Energy production can also vary due to weather conditions, shading, and roof orientation. Some homeowners may need roof repairs or electrical upgrades before installation. Equipment replacement or maintenance costs may occur over the system's lifespan.

How long does it take for solar panels to pay for themselves in Chico?

Solar panel payback periods typically range from 6 to 12 years, depending on system cost, energy usage, electricity rates, and available incentives. Higher utility costs can shorten the payback period. After reaching payback, ongoing energy savings may continue for many years. Actual timelines vary by household and system performance.

What happens if my roof needs replacement after solar installation in Chico?

If a roof requires replacement after solar panels have been installed, the system usually needs to be removed and reinstalled. This process can add additional labor and project costs. Many homeowners choose to evaluate roof condition before installing solar panels to avoid future disruptions. Proper planning can help minimize long-term expenses.
